Gday All

I have a issue with Borriss he going flat over night, It seems the Ignition soleniod might be turning on by itself..  let me explain.

Basically I turn the Key Off but everything stays on but not always.

It sounds like the GlowPlugs relay is going in and out 

The Interior fan goes on off on off

You can push the Sub Tank button and it still works.  Things like this

 

This mainly happens after rain..

 

So i am thinking there is a main Ignition relay that is getting damp and playing up.

Any info would be great ,   I have been told there is a relay in the dash that requires the dash to be pulled out.

I am planning on getting the rust around the windscreen fixed after i get this sorted out as i know its not good for water to get in with the elctrics.
